Approval of Agenda: The time at which the agenda is approved. Councilmembers or the City Manager
may also suggest adding, withdrawing or moving the order of items on the agenda at this time. A
simple majority of Councilmembers present may vote to approve as written or as amended.
Communications – Written and Oral: This agenda item provides an opportunity for members of the
public to address the Council on any subject except quasi-judicial matters or matters scheduled for a
public hearing before the Council. The total time for oral communications is 30 minutes, and speakers
must limit their presentation to 3 minutes. A maximum of three persons are permitted to speak to
each side of any one topic.
Consent Calendar: Those matters of business that require action by the Council which are considered
to be of a routine and non-controversial nature are placed on the consent calendar. The individual
items on the consent calendar are typically approved, adopted, or enacted by one motion of the
Council.
Study Session Items: Council reviews and determines the approach to be used on significant policy
issues, to receive progress reports on current issues, or to receive information from the City
Manager, staff, or other regional officials.
Public Hearings: Hearings held to receive public comment on important matters before the Council,
allowing the public an opportunity to provide input for Council consideration in the decision-making
process.
Land Use: This is the point on the agenda when land use matters, including the City Hearing
Examiners’ decisions and recommendations on various land use applications, as well as appeals, are
taken up for Council discussion and action. Often the items taken up under this agenda item are
quasi-judicial in nature.
Quasi-Judicial: Matters where the Council acts in their judicial capacity rather than their legislative
capacity.
Quorum: Minimum number of voting members who must be present for business to be conducted. A
quorum of the Bellevue City Council is four (4) members, a simple majority
Ordinance: Ordinances are legislative acts or local laws. They are the most permanent and binding
form of Council action and may be changed or repealed only by a subsequent ordinance.
Resolution: Legislation that is adopted to express the policy of the Council or to direct certain types
of administrative action.
Motion: A motion is typically used to indicate majority approval of a procedural action or to authorize
disposition of routine items of business on the Council agenda. It may also be used to direct staff to
take certain administrative actions.

Executive Session: Private sessions that may be held by the City Council only for the purposes
specified in RCW 42.30.110. These include, but are not limited to, issues concerning the buying and
selling of real property, certain personnel issues, and litigation. The purpose and length of Executive
Sessions is publicly announced prior to recessing into Executive Session.
